The Sherman Silver Purchase Act (policy) (jul 14, 1890 – jul 14, 1893)
Description:
Event: "It increased the amount of silver the government was required to purchase on a recurrent monthly basis to 4.5 million ounces,(Socolofsky)" expanding the money supply.
Impact: By inflating the currency, the price of crops increased and make their debt payments cheaper as well.
